The road to life is a disciplined life; ignore correction and you’re lost for good.
Proverbs 10:17 MSG
Discipline is a strange word. Man does not like it, yet he cannot amount to much without it. God cannot do without it; in fact, it is his tool to model us after his own pattern. Life itself is delicate and calls for caution for all who will enjoy it. The idea of what man calls 'enjoyment' is a far cry from what God refers to as true life itself.
Anyone who will truly live the life of purpose and direction that God intends has to go through the path of discipline. The world defines it 'as the practice of training people to obey rules or a code of behaviour, using punishment to correct disobedience'. The world cannot compel right living without the threat of punishment.
God defines discipline from the viewpoint of love and a desire to make a life better. Hebrews 12:6-7 KJV says: 'For whom the Lord loveth he chasteneth, and scourgeth every son whom he receiveth. If ye endure chastening, God dealeth with you as with sons; for what son is he whom the father chasteneth not? '
As you travel on the road called life, situations, circumstances and events will come to test the quality and depths of your knowledge of God and his will. If you know who God truly is, compromise is difficult. When you do not know who you are or who you belong to, then you are prone to the dictates of an uncertain world. When God corrects, your present and eternal life is the focus. When God disciplines, he's preparing you for the great things that are ahead. If you ignore God's promptings, you will get lost. When nothing cautions you in your decisions and planning, then you are set up for a great fall. When God cautions you and you heed his warnings, rebuke, correction and discipline, impact is nonnegotiable. His time of favour is here.
